Prometric centres offer better facilities, including keyboards for writing section.

They maintain strict silence and consistent air conditioning. Choosing Prometric reduces technical distractions. It helps you focus entirely on your score during GRE.

Prometric centres are official venues offering high quality keyboards and noise-cancelling headphones.

Private centres are third-party locations. Often in colleges. Private centres have more available slots. Prometric centres provide a more professional, quiet, and reliable environment for your exam.
